A 30-L electrical radiator containing heating oil is placed in a 50-m3 room. Both the room and the oil in the radiator are initially at 10°C. The radiator with a rating of 1.8 kW is now turned on. At the same time, heat is lost from the room at an average rate of 0.35kJ/s. After some time, the average temperature is measured to be 20°C for the air in the room, and 50°C for the oil in the radiator. Taking the density and the specific heat of the oil to be 950 kg/m3 and 2.2 kJ/kg °C, respectively, determine how long the heater is kept on. Assume the room is well-sealed so that there are no air leaks.
